  15. DDDDEEEESSSSCCCCRRRRIIIIPPPPTTTTIIIIOOOONNNN
  16.      _tttt_iiii_mmmm_eeee_rrrr______gggg_eeee_tttt_oooo_vvvv_eeee_rrrr_rrrr_uuuu_nnnn returns the current expiration notification overrun
  17.      count for the posix timer named by _t_i_m_e_r_i_d.
  18.  
  19.      An overrun count is the number of timer expiration notifications which
  20.      were not delivered to the process due to an already pending signal from
  21.      _t_i_m_e_r_i_d.  This overrun condition may occur because a given posix timer
  22.      can only queue one signal to the process at any point in time.
  23.  
  24.      If the returned overrun count is positive, then the count represents the
  25.      number of timer overruns up to, but not including {_DDDD_EEEE_LLLL_AAAA_YYYY_TTTT_IIII_MMMM_EEEE_RRRR______MMMM_AAAA_XXXX} [see
  26.      _ssss_yyyy_ssss_cccc_oooo_nnnn_ffff(3C)].
  27.  
  28.      If the returned overrun count is zero, then no timer expiration overruns
  29.      have occurred between the last expiration notification and the time of
  30.      the call to _tttt_iiii_mmmm_eeee_rrrr______gggg_eeee_tttt_oooo_vvvv_eeee_rrrr_rrrr_uuuu_nnnn.
  31.  
  32.      _tttt_iiii_mmmm_eeee_rrrr______gggg_eeee_tttt_oooo_vvvv_eeee_rrrr_rrrr_uuuu_nnnn will fail if the following is true:
  33.  
  34.      [EINVAL]    The _t_i_m_e_r_i_d does not name a valid posix timer.
